Gibraltar

Gibraltar is the destination for today's cruise, and what a day our three groups of holiday-makers have to look forward to. Our young couple from Manchester, Rosie and James, head straight to the cable cars, and enjoy panoramic views towards both Spain and Africa, as they scale the famous 426 metre rock of Gibraltar. Once at the top, they are met by Gibraltar's wild monkeys, a cheeky population of Barbary Macaques that have inhabited the rock, and entertained its visitors, for centuries. The couple treat themselves to an indulgent late lunch at the glamourous Rock Hotel, often frequented by celebrities and royals. Back on board, the pair try their luck at the ship's quiz. First time cruiser Beverley, who has a fear of ships and bridges, is still getting used to life on the seas. Together with husband Darren, she braves the gangway to get off the ship, and is rewarded by a sunny day on shore. The pair head inside Gibraltar's rock to explore its two hundred year-old siege tunnels. Once they return to the ship, a treat is in store for keen drummer Darren, as one of the ship's musicians agrees to let him loose on his drum kit. It's a day at Gibraltar's Alameda Wildlife and Conservation Park for our final family. After exploring the beautiful grounds, eight-year-old Yasmina is given the opportunity to hand feed some rescue Lemurs, along with Dad Mark and Grandma Amina. A restful afternoon on the ship allows for some creative flair, as the family have a go at decorating masks.
